Nextivity aims to improve connectivity in vehicles, boats with CEL-FI ROAM R41 mobile cellular coverage solution

Nextivity, a specialist in intelligent cellular coverage solutions, has released the CEL-FI ROAM R41. The R41 is the release in the Nextivity ROAM line, which addresses nomadic applications providing cellular coverage on the move without additional charges. Continuing the legacy of the CEL-FI GO G31 and GO G32 mobile repeaters, ROAM R41 offers enterprise-grade performance to solve poor cellular coverage challenges and enable dependable calling, texting, and data away from home or the office. The system is claimed to be easy to install under seats or in other discrete locations inside any land vehicle or boat. (more…)

Talkie Communications closes connectivity gap in Maryland with Adtran broadband platform

Adtran has announced that Talkie Communications is utilising its flexible XGS-PON (10 gigabit symmetrical passive optical network) fibre broadband solution to offer high-speed services to businesses and residential customers in Maryland. The deployment features Adtran’s Total Access 5000 (TA5000), a high-capacity multi-service fibre access platform that facilitates 10Gbit/s connectivity. With the new infrastructure, Talkie Communications is enabling its subscribers to harness digital resources, such as telemedicine and online learning. The solution is also helping the service provider to bridge the state’s digital divide by offering a range of affordable, high-speed tiers that ensure connectivity for all. (more…)

Laser Light Companies, Nokia to accelerate, scale deployment of all-optical global network

Laser Light Companies and Nokia have agreed on a $25 million (€22.88) (USD) Beta Programme to commence the deployment of Laser Light’s planned global all-optical network. In the agreement, Laser Light will use Nokia optical and IP solutions and technologies to enable the first stage of its planned Extended Ground Network System (“XGNS”) to reach and serve diverse locations. Following the initial Beta in Australia, other Beta locations are planned for the United StatesChileSpain, and Africa later this year. When completed, Laser Light and Nokia’s Beta Programme will operate a meshed global platform connecting 5 continents, enabling demonstration of advanced data services and the platform to support integration activities ahead of the global commercial network.
